Philippines Says No Deal With Islamists Who Seized Marawi

MANILA/MARAWI CITY, Philippines (Reuters) - The Philippines ruled out negotiations on Tuesday with Islamist militants holding hostages and occupying a southern town, after reports that a rebel leader wanted to trade a Catholic priest for his parents being held by police.
